The truth is, the core mechanics of the Chicken Road Game are not inherently a scam. The concept of a multiplier-based crash game has been around for years in various forms — think of the popular “crash” games found on many crypto casinos. In those games, a value rises until it randomly stops, and players must cash out before it does. Chicken Road works on a similar principle, wrapped in a cartoon aesthetic. The question of legitimacy therefore boils down to the platform’s honesty in two key areas: provably fair technology and actual payout rates. If the platform publishes verifiable seeds and allows you to check each round’s fairness, that is a strong green flag. If everything is hidden behind a closed curtain, red flags should wave.

What the Chicken Road Game Really Is

At its heart, Chicken Road is an online gambling game, not a video game you beat with practice. This distinction matters. Many newcomers assume that because the chicken moves across a road with obstacles, there must be some skill involved — like timing or pattern recognition. In reality, the outcome of each round is determined by a pseudo-random algorithm (or, in dishonest cases, a manually controlled one). The obstacles are not generated in real time based on player input; they are part of a pre-set mathematical model designed to give the house an edge. This does not automatically make it illegitimate — all legal gambling has a house edge — but it does mean you should not expect to win consistently through clever play.

Common Red Flags and Green Flags

If you are considering trying Chicken Road, keep these warning signs and positive indicators in mind. They will help you make a more informed choice rather than relying on flashy advertisements or promises of easy money.

  • Green flag: The platform allows you to check the fairness of each round using a client seed, server seed, and nonce. This is the gold standard for trust in online gambling.
  • Red flag: The game has no visible “fairness” section and support staff cannot explain how outcomes are generated. This usually means you are flying blind.
  • Green flag: Withdrawals are processed quickly and without unreasonable fees or delays. Legit platforms want you to get your winnings, not trap them.
  • Red flag: The platform actively discourages you from withdrawing by requiring huge wagering requirements or sending endless bonus offers that tie up your funds.
  • Green flag: The community around the game is active and includes both winning and losing stories. No gambling game has 100% positive feedback from real players.
  • Red flag: Every review you find sounds like a paid testimonial or a bot-written rave. Trust the realistic voices, not the perfect ones.

FAQ About Chicken Road Game Legitimacy

Can you actually win real money playing Chicken Road?

Yes, it is possible to win real money, but the game is designed so the house has an edge over time. Short-term wins happen, but long-term profitability is statistically unlikely for most players.

Is Chicken Road Game a scam?

Not inherently. The game itself is a legitimate gambling product when offered by a transparent, licensed operator. It becomes a scam when the platform manipulates outcomes, refuses payouts, or misleads players about the odds.

How do I check if a Chicken Road platform is safe?

Look for a verifiable gambling license, provably fair technology, clear terms of service, and a history of real user feedback across independent forums. If any of these are missing, be cautious.

Does skill matter in Chicken Road?

No. The game is purely chance-based. No amount of practice or timing will change the outcome because each round is determined by an algorithm at the moment you place your bet.

Are there any strategies to guarantee wins?

No strategy can guarantee a win in a game of chance. Betting patterns like Martingale may change how you manage your bankroll, but they do not affect the underlying odds. The only reliable strategy is to set a budget and stick to it.
